Está en la página 1de 2

Estructuras de datos

Clase introductoria

Reglas
La asistencia en este curso es voluntaria. Sin embargo, si
decide atender a clase, se deben seguir estas dos
indicaciones sencillas:

Contenido
Presentacin del curso
Metodologa de trabajo y de evaluacin
Cronograma del semestre

Respetar a los compaeros y al profesor: silenciar los


celulares, dejar las charlas personales para afuera
del saln, prestar atencin,

Material elaborado por: Julin Moreno

Las notas son responsabilidad del estudiante, NO


DEL PROFESOR. Al final del semestre no usar los
cuentos de me van a echar por el PAPA , me van
a quitar la beca , el promedio me va a quedar muy
bajito, aunque la pierda que me quede altca

Facultad de Minas, Departamento de Ciencias de la Computacin y la Decisin

Metodologa que deberan seguir


Clase Terica

Antes:

Repasar clase terica anterior

Durante:

Prestar atencin y tomar apuntes


Realizar ejercicios cuando se pongan
Formular preguntas

Despus: Realizar los ejercicios del taller que correspondan


Contrastar con lo aprendido anteriormente

Clase Prctica

Antes:

Repasar clases terica y prctica anterior

Durante:

Prestar atencin y tomar apuntes


Realizar los ejercicios
Formular preguntas

Despus: Terminar los ejercicios que no se alcancen


Contrastar con lo aprendido anteriormente

Asesoras y repasos
Importante: No deben dejar
acumular contenidos

Antes:

Repasar las clases que correspondan

Durante:

Prestar atencin y tomar apuntes


Llevar preguntas

Despus: Hacer los ejercicios de nuevo por si mismos

Dedicacin horaria
Un crdito es la unidad que mide el tiempo que el estudiante
requiere para cumplir a cabalidad los objetivos de formacin de cada
asignatura y equivale a 48 horas de trabajo del estudiante. ste
incluir las actividades presenciales que se desarrollan en las aulas
con el profesor, las actividades con orientacin docente realizadas
fuera de las aulas y las actividades autnomas llevadas a cabo por el
estudiante, adems de prcticas, preparacin de exmenes y todas
aquellas que sean necesarias para alcanzar las metas de
aprendizaje.
Art. 6, Acuerdo CSU 033 de 2007

48 x 3 = 144 horas totales de dedicacin al curso


18 x 4 = 72 horas presenciales (teora y prctica)
144 72 = 72 horas de trabajo personal

Informacin del curso

Estadsticas

Cancelaciones o
abandonos
(23%)
Ingeniera
biolgica 3%

Otros 2%

Ingeniera
mecnica
3%

Estadstica
25%
Ingeniera de
sistemas e
informtica
67%

Aprobaciones
(49%)
Reprobaciones
(28%)

Ver video

Contenido detallado y evaluaciones

Objetivos del curso

Caracterizar y manipular estructuras de datos para


usarlas dentro de problemas algortmicos en procura
de su eficiencia.

Desarrollar la capacidad de implementar dichas


estructuras en un lenguaje de programacin
especfico.

Pre-requisitos:
Fundamentos de programacin
Sintaxis bsica de Java

Parcial 1: 24%
Ejercicios talleres: 6%
Entrega 1 del trabajo: 4%

Eficiencia algortmica y notacin Big Oh


Arreglos (estticos y dinmicos)
Listas enlazadas
Pilas y colas

Parcial 2: 23%
Ejercicios talleres: 6%
Entrega 2 del trabajo: 4%

rboles
Binarios de bsqueda
AVL
Rojo-Negro
b+

Parcial 3: 23%
Ejercicios talleres: 6%
Entrega 3 del trabajo: 4%

Heaps
Colas con prioridad
Tablas hash

Advertencia: no hacer a consciencia los talleres y los tarbajos es un mal


negocio: por ganar un 30% de mala manera, lo ms probable es que
pierdan el 70% restante

Importante: Las clases prcticas no comienzan sino hasta la


prxima semana!!!

Tareas
1. Crear un usuario en: http://guiame.medellin.unal.edu.co/cpp
y matricularse en el curso Estructuras de datos usando la
contrasea ED2014-2 (sin las comillas). All encontrarn:
Diapositivas de las clases tericas y prcticas
Ejercicios (talleres)
Foros de discusin
Documentos, manuales y enlaces de inters
2. Aprender Java en 8 das (hay examen la prxima semana!).
Para esto deben leer, como mnimo, los documentos:
Manual de instalacin y uso de NetBeans
Curso rpido de Java
Y por ltimo

También podría gustarte